Early Life and Education

Born September 12, 1951, Avner Hershlag is 73 in 2023. Born in Israel to Mania Portman and Zvi Yehuda Hershlag, he is Israeli. He started his medical education at Jerusalem’s Hadassah Medical Center. He later attended George Washington University Hospital to improve his medical skills.

Career Achievements

Dr. Avner Hershlag is a prominent figure in reproductive medicine. He has shaped obstetrics, gynecology, and reproductive endocrinology for over 30 years. Hershlag is dual board-certified in various disciplines, demonstrating his knowledge and dedication.

He helped launch successful programs at Northwell Health, a major New York healthcare organization. He pioneered preimplantation genetic testing (PGT), egg freezing, cancer patient fertility preservation, and donor egg programs, which fall under third-party reproduction.

Dr. Hershlag is a Clinical Professor of Obstetrics, Gynecology, and Reproductive Medicine at Stony Brook University’s Renaissance School of Medicine. He also teaches at Hofstra/Zucker School of Medicine, helping train future doctors.

Personal Life

In addition to his professional accomplishments, Dr. Avner Hershlag is known as the father of Natalie Portman, a famous actress. Avner and Shelley Stevens had Natalie on June 9, 1981, in West Jerusalem, Mount Scopus. Natalie credits her parents for keeping her grounded amidst Hollywood demands.

Avner Hershlag is married to Ohio artist Shelley Stevens and has one daughter, Natalie Portman. The Hershlag family stays close despite their varied careers.
